The Los Angeles Rams did not leave Seattle wondering if Matthew Stafford can still play. That question was answered at Lumen Field. What lingered instead was how long the franchise can realistically ride with him as its only plan at quarterback.Stafford threw for 374 yards and three touchdowns in a 31–27 loss to the Seahawks in the NFC Championship game. The Rams gained 479 total yards and stayed within one score until the final minutes. Still, the season ended short of a Super Bowl, and the timing of the loss pushed future planning into the open.

Rams are predicted to trade up for a Matthew Stafford successor in 2026

The Sporting News highlighted a projection from ESPN analyst Aaron Schatz that pointed directly to the 2026 NFL Draft. In an ESPN futures analysis published after the conference championship weekend, Schatz predicted the Rams would move aggressively to secure their next quarterback.“The Rams will trade up in the draft for a quarterback,” Schatz wrote in the ESPN article. “They need a young talent for when Stafford is ready to hang ’em up, whether that’s this offseason or in a few years. What better time to plan for the future than when they have two first-round picks?”The quote reflects long-term strategy, not an imminent breakup.
Stafford turns 38 in February and remains under contract through the 2026 season. He showed no physical decline in 2025 and guided the Rams past the Panthers in the wild-card round and the Bears in the divisional round before the loss in Seattle.After the game, Stafford made it clear he had no interest in discussing his future. Speaking to reporters in the Rams locker room, he said he could not summarize months of decisions minutes after a playoff defeat and wanted to keep the focus on the team’s run.Head coach Sean McVay took a similar stance during his postgame press conference on January 25. He declined to address Stafford’s future and instead pointed to execution and missed chances, including a failed fourth-and-4 at the Seattle 6-yard line with under five minutes left.That tension explains why the draft projection exists. The Rams remain in a win-now window. At the same time, quarterback transitions punish teams that wait too long. Trading up in 2026 would allow Los Angeles to prepare without forcing change too early. The conversation is not about replacing Stafford today. It is about making sure the Rams are not unprepared tomorrow.
